linux 命令实践 - grep

 个人认为非常重要的命令,一定要掌握,常与 管道搭配使用。

grep 用于查找文件中符合条件的字符串或正则表达式。

grep 指令用于查找内容包含指定的范本样式的文件,如果发现某文件的内容符合所指定的范本样式预设 grep 指令会把含有范本样式的那一列显示出来。若不指定任何文件名称,或是所给予的文件名为 -,则 grep 指令会从标准输入设备读取数据。

格式:

grep [options] pattern [file]

 常用的选项:

-i        忽略大小写进行匹配

-v        反向查找,只打印不匹配的行

-n        显示匹配行的行号

-r        递归查找子目录中的文件

-l        只打印匹配的文件名

-c        只打印匹配的行数

-w        全词匹配

其中 pattern 可以是简单字符串也可以是正则表达式,可以带双引号也可以不带,但建议带上,

注:

-v        invert

-i        ignore

-n        number

-r        recursive

-w        word

-c        count

-l        file

  • 13
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值